The provisions of this act are severable. If any portion of the act is declared unconstitutional or invalid, or the application of any portion of the act 1 to any person or circumstance is held unconstitutional or invalid, the invalidity shall not affect other portions of the act that can be given effect without the invalid portion or application, and the applicability of such other portions of the act to any person or circumstance shall remain valid and enforceable.
